Hi All

When I use the unified interface in the lead form and click on any of the options to disqualify a lead, nothing happens

When I do the same from the view, it works.

What could be some of the potential reasons that I can check?

    RE: Disqualify Lead - nothing happens

    Hello,

    Please, use the article to troubleshooting your form ribbon: support.microsoft.com/.../ribbon-troubleshooting-guide-0b243404-f970-8317-adf5-a0ce6ef79a36

    To enable the Command Checker, you must append a parameter &ribbondebug=true to your D365 application URL. For example: yourorgname.crm.dynamics.com/main.aspx

    Also, this scenario could be caused by a Business Rule defined for the main form.
